Strait of Hormuz: How many ships are getting through?
Another tanker, the US-sanctioned Elpis, transited the strait on Tuesday and may have come from the Iranian port of Bushehr, according to MarineTraffic. The tracking data showed the vessel stationary on the eastern side of the strait on Tuesday evening.
